How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Elk Grove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Elk Grove Village Studio Apartments | $1,855 | $1,220 | $2,285 |
Elk Grove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,921 | $1,333 | $3,053 |
| Elk Grove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,345 | $1,440 | $3,760 |
| Elk Grove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,897 | $2,010 | $4,848 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Elk Grove Village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Elk Grove Village with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Elk Grove Village is at Rose Glen Senior listed at $1,333.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Elk Grove Village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Elk Grove Village is $1,921.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Elk Grove Village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Elk Grove Village is a 946 square feet unit starting from $1,998 at Aria Luxury Apartments.
What is the average size for Elk Grove Village 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Elk Grove Village is currently 1,000 sq ft.
